About Prospect Elem School

Prospect Elementary School serves 313 students in grades kindergarten through five in Clarendon Hills, Illinois. The school earns a composite score of 9.5 out of 10 — an Exceptional rating — driven by a near-perfect academic score of 10.0 and a strong growth score of 9.2. With a student-teacher ratio of 10.8 to 1, students get consistent, close attention in the classroom.

The academic results place Prospect among Illinois's elite public schools. It ranks 26th out of 3,813 public schools statewide, outperforming 99% of Illinois schools overall. Among elementary schools specifically, it climbs even higher — ranking 23rd out of 2,326 elementary schools across the state.

Locally, it holds the top spot among all four public schools in Clarendon Hills. What makes these numbers meaningful is that Prospect achieves them with strong growth scores alongside high achievement — indicating that students are advancing steadily, not just arriving academically prepared. Community Profile

The community surrounding Prospect Elem School has a median household income of $114,672. It is a well-educated community where 74%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$568,300, with a median rent of $1,195/month. The local poverty rate of 8.4%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 29 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about Prospect Elem School

What grades does Prospect Elem School serve?

Prospect Elem School serves students in grades Kindergarten through 5th.

How many students attend Prospect Elem School?

Prospect Elem School has an enrollment of approximately 313 students.

What is the student-teacher ratio at Prospect Elem School?

The student-teacher ratio at Prospect Elem School is 10.8:1. A lower ratio generally means more individual attention per student. The national average is approximately 16:1 for public schools.

How does Prospect Elem School rank in IL?

Prospect Elem School is ranked #26 out of 3,813 schools in IL.

What is Prospect Elem School's MySchoolScout rating?

Prospect Elem School has a composite rating of 9.5 out of 10 on MySchoolScout. This score combines academic performance, student growth, and school environment into a single score. Equity data is shown separately for context.

What are the test scores at Prospect Elem School?

Based on the most recent state assessment data, Prospect Elem School has 81.0% math proficiency and 76.3% reading/ELA proficiency.

Is Prospect Elem School a charter school?

No, Prospect Elem School is not a charter school. It is a traditional public school operated by the local school district.

Is Prospect Elem School a Title I school?

No, Prospect Elem School is not currently a Title I school.
